This document provides information about the concept of representation that will be useful for analyzing a media production for a critical perspectives exam. It defines representation as how media re-presents or constructs meanings about the world. It discusses key questions to consider when analyzing representation, such as what concepts are highlighted, what representations are generated, and if there are any stereotypes. The document also discusses theories of representation, such as how gender is typically represented in media according to theorists like Berger and Mulvey. It provides several quotes about representation that could be cited. Finally, it discusses concepts like the "male gaze," the "final girl" trope in horror, and how different genres like zombies films can represent cultural ideas.
